halcon 热力图
时间: 2023-10-25 12:03:52 浏览: 255
Halcon热力图是一个用于图像处理和分析的强大工具。它可以将图像中不同区域的温度或其他物理量以不同的颜色或亮度进行可视化呈现,帮助我们更直观地理解图像的特征和分布。
在使用Halcon热力图时,首先需要对图像进行预处理。例如,对于红外热像仪拍摄的图像,需要将其转换为温度值。之后,可以根据需要选择相应的颜色映射表,将温度范围映射到颜色空间中。常见的映射方式有线性映射、对数映射、指数映射等。这些颜色映射表可以帮助我们在热力图中准确地反映温度不同区域的变化情况。
除了温度,Halcon热力图还可以用于表示其他物理量,如压力、电流等。我们可以根据不同物理量的变化范围和需求,选择合适的颜色映射表和范围。
在热力图生成后,我们可以通过分析图像中不同颜色或亮度的区域,来获取一些有用的信息。例如,可以通过检测高温区域来发现潜在的问题,指导采取相应的措施。同时,也可以利用热力图来评估产品或设备的性能,优化设计。
总之,Halcon热力图是一种有效的图像处理和分析工具,可以将图像中不同区域的温度或其他物理量以直观的方式呈现,帮助我们更好地理解图像的特征和分布,为决策和优化提供依据。
相关问题
halcon dlt 热力图查看
Halcon DLT是一种用于图像处理和机器视觉的软件库。在Halcon DLT中,可以使用离散点信息创建热力图,并通过一系列步骤来查看热力图。
首先,需要为每个离散点创建一个Mask。Mask是一个圆形区域,其半径表示该点对最终热力图像产生影响的区域半径。中心点的权重为1,边缘部分的权重逐渐减小,可以使用线性变化或二次曲线等方式进行渐变。\[1\]
然后,将所有离散点的Mask叠加,生成一幅灰度图像。相邻Mask的重叠部分进行权重累加操作,最终灰度图中每个像素点的数值大小就是所有与其相关的Mask中的权重之和。离散点密度越高的地方,灰度图中像素点的数值越高,即图像越亮。\[2\]
在Halcon DLT中,可以按照以下步骤来生成和查看热力图:
1. 生成一个灰度图像,像素值范围为0-255。
2. 对每个像素点赋予相同的灰度值,例如127。
3. 根据图像的尺寸进行裁剪,得到一个新的图像。
4. 循环遍历图像的每个像素点,设置其灰度值。可以使用嵌套的循环来实现。
5. 最后,将图像转换为RGB格式,并显示出来。可以使用Halcon DLT提供的函数来实现。\[3\]
通过以上步骤,可以生成并查看Halcon DLT中的热力图。
#### 引用[.reference_title]
- *1* *2* [热力图(HeatMap)实现](https://blog.csdn.net/weixin_29861235/article/details/111989431)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[halcon灰度图转热力图 / 真彩色——绘制彩虹](https://blog.csdn.net/sunnyrainflower/article/details/129410873)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
halcon 直方图
Halcon中的直方图是一种用于分析图像亮度分布的工具。可以通过直方图来调整图像的对比度和亮度等参数,从而达到更好的图像处理效果。在Halcon中,可以使用灰度直方图和彩色直方图两种类型的直方图来分析图像。灰度直方图用于分析灰度图像的亮度分布,而彩色直方图则用于分析彩色图像的亮度分布。通过直方图可以直观地了解图像的亮度分布情况,从而更好地进行图像处理和分析。
1. 如何在Halcon中生成灰度直方图和彩色直方图?
2. 如何利用直方图来调整图像的对比度和亮度等参数?
3. 在Halcon中如何进行图像分割和边缘检测?
阅读全文